Christ 07-21-2009 02:17 AM

The Saturn goes in today (Tuesday) for service.

Turns out the closest dealer to me is in Binghamton, and I have to tow it, though Saturn will reimburse me for the tow if the dealer does the recall service.

Dealer says that they'll replace the timing chain kit, but they won't replace anything else that's wrong w/ the engine, if anything. I say this is BS, because the timing chains are on a mandatory recall from NHTSA, and if it broke/slipped, and anything in the (interference) engine was damaged as a result of the faulty chain, it should also be replaced under the recall.

If they choose to only replace the timing chain, I'll be speaking with Saturn again, in the event that there was other damage that should be attributable to the timing chain problem, such as bent valves, broken pistons, etc.

I spun the cams over, and didn't notice any rockers lifting away from the valve stems, but that isn't the correct way to check, as minute bends won't show with this method.
